Istanbul Tulip Festival
The Istanbul Tulip Festival, known as Istanbul Lale Festivali in Turkish, is a dazzling celebration of nature’s beauty and cultural heritage organized by the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ality. Since its inception, the festival has become a beloved tradition in the city, drawing locals and tourists alike to marvel at the breathtaking displays of tulips that adorn the parks and public spaces of Istanbul.
In 2015, the Istanbul Tulip Festival marked its milestone 10th edition, further solidifying its status as one of the city’s most cherished events. Each year, millions of tulips burst into bloom throughout Istanbul, transforming the urban landscape into a vibrant tapestry of colors and fragrances.
Beyond the sheer spectacle of blooming tulips, the Istanbul Tulip Festival offers a myriad of events and activities that showcase the rich cultural heritage of the city. One of the highlights of the festival is the creation of a stunning tulip carpet, where thousands of tulips are meticulously arranged to form intricate patterns and designs, paying homage to the centuries-old tradition of Turkish carpet weaving.

Location: Istanbul, Turkey
Opening beginning of April – beginning of May
For 2015 more than 20 million tulips of 192 varieties have been planted in the parks.
